It is much more user friendly than XP so I fail to see why you have problems in finding My Computer and My Documents. As for slowing your machine down you can always disable some of the effects by right clicking Computer and going to Properties > Advanced system settings > Settings (under Performance).

Hi There Depending on which Windows 7 version was supplied with your laptop. Professional and upwards entitles you to a FREE Windows XP SP3 Virtual Machine which you can deploy all your old XP stuff and run just like you had it before. XP Mode setup guide here Regards
